We traveled with our three adult children, ages 23, 21, and 19, and everyone had the best time! | | |Travel |The resort will arrange seamless transport for you, from the airport (PLS) to a private hangar, all arranged by the resort. We used one of the SkyPass services, and this expedited our arrival and departure. From the moment you arrive at the private hangar, you don't have to worry about a thing! After approximately an 18-minute flight (admittedly, I prayed the first 5 minutes, then settled down). You arrive at the lovely Ambergris Cay, where you will be greeted with champagne, and your luggage is whisked away and will be waiting for you in your bungalow or villa. | |Island guide |You will next meet your Island guide (ours was Victor). From activities to dinner reservations, spa appointments, and special food requests. EVERYTHING | |Travel around the island. |All done by golf cart. We were a party of 5 and were assigned two carts. Having more than one cart made things easier since we didn't all have to stick to the same schedule. Someone could easily run to the fitness center or beach club without needing a ride! Admittedly, you will get slightly dusty.. It's fine, you're washable, and it makes the most sense to travel around the island, and they encourage exploration! The beach is well equipped with kayaks, paddleboards, a Hobie Cat, and a trampoline. We did not take advantage of them, but they were available. |Pickleball and tennis courts are also available, and a free one-hour lesson with the pro is an option. We were a party of five and opted for a four-bedroom villa. The villa's location was a bit longer golf cart ride to the restaurants and beach club, but it didn't matter. We had great privacy, unbelievable views, the most beautiful pool you can imagine, and it was an adventure! Every bedroom had its own en-suite, and there was plenty of room for all of us. I spoke with many guests, including large parties in the villas and smaller groups in the bungalows, and I did not hear one negative thing. Everyone loved their accommodations. Nespresso machines for coffee, espresso, and cappuccino in your villa or bungalow to have while you watch the sun rise, amazing! And a refrigerator stocked with juices, wine, and soda. Whatever you requested on your preference sheet is all there. In addition to that, there are snacks of granola bars and chips that are all continually restocked, as is the refrigerator. | |Dining |Breakfast is fantastic and at your leisure, as is lunch. I bring my Mac on every trip and usually check work emails, etc. I put it in the safe when we arrived and never opened it once! | |Tipping etiquette |While you will NEVER be asked for a gratuity anywhere, be a good person and tip well! Every dinner we had (for five people) would have equated to $500 (sans alcohol) at a Minimum!!! So tip accordingly. Assigning tips can all be done at checkout time, and you do not have to give it a thought throughout your stay. If you request to tip, they will provide you with envelopes for cash, and you assign a staff member to it, or you can add it onto your card and again assign names and amounts. Cash discreetly given also works. | |I have never experienced a better trip. The five-star service far surpasses any Ritz or Four Seasons anywhere in the world. We will be back.
